youtubereporting.v1 library Null safety

YouTube Reporting API - v1

Schedules reporting jobs containing your YouTube Analytics data and downloads the resulting bulk data reports in the form of CSV files.

For more information, see developers.google.com/youtube/reporting/v1/reports/

Create an instance of YouTubeReportingApi to access these resources:

Classes

ByteRange
Specifies a range of media.
DownloadOptions
Represents options for downloading media.
GdataBlobstore2Info
gdata
GdataCompositeMedia
gdata
GdataContentTypeInfo
gdata
GdataDiffChecksumsResponse
gdata
GdataDiffDownloadResponse
gdata
GdataDiffUploadRequest
gdata
GdataDiffUploadResponse
gdata
GdataDiffVersionResponse
gdata
GdataDownloadParameters
gdata
GdataMedia
gdata
GdataObjectId
gdata
Job
A job creating reports of a specific type.
JobsReportsResource
JobsResource
ListJobsResponse
Response message for ReportingService.ListJobs.
ListReportsResponse
Response message for ReportingService.ListReports.
ListReportTypesResponse
Response message for ReportingService.ListReportTypes.
Media
Represents a media consisting of a stream of bytes, a content type and a length.
MediaResource
PartialDownloadOptions
Options for downloading a Media.
Report
A report's metadata including the URL from which the report itself can be downloaded.
ReportType
A report type.
ReportTypesResource
ResumableUploadOptions
Specifies options for resumable uploads.
UploadOptions
Represents options for uploading a Media.
YouTubeReportingApi
Schedules reporting jobs containing your YouTube Analytics data and downloads the resulting bulk data reports in the form of CSV files.

Typedefs

Empty = $Empty
A generic empty message that you can re-use to avoid defining duplicated empty messages in your APIs.

Exceptions / Errors

ApiRequestError
Represents a general error reported by the API endpoint.
DetailedApiRequestError
Represents a specific error reported by the API endpoint.